Output 3bdabcd979ec3da8df3fd06fa691854d6aea30e906bac6d5e02e6c21e7eca457:1

value
852459439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d05da506c40c910ff33b916e0841912f26f950 OP_EQUAL
address
37saouVqBrJzxAq78g6WNYqPbyLjELUjCU
transaction
3bdabcd979ec3da8df3fd06fa691854d6aea30e906bac6d5e02e6c21e7eca457
spent
true